open Swig (* Give access to the swig library *)
open Example (* This is the name of your swig output *)
let results = _foo '() (* Function names are prefixed with _ in order to make
them lex as identifiers in ocaml. Consider that
uppercase identifiers are module names in ocaml.
NOTE: the '() syntax is part of swigp4. You can do:
let results = _foo C_void *)
(* Since your function has a return value in addition to the string output,
you'll need to match them as a list *)
let result_string =
match results with
C_list [ C_string result_string ; C_int 0 ] -> (* The return value is
last when out arguments appear, but this too can be customized.
We're also checking that the function succeeded. *)
result_string
| _ -> raise (Failure "Expected string, int reply from _foo")
let _ = print_endline result_string
